Output 264210a42ff77c6f5bfb33faa8650b360deb3244649adb8c601f8f00e3b7aa89:1

value
365709438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ea45278aafbd3030b39b009fcd3a64dbe8d271f8 OP_EQUAL
address
3P3itNJpuQvCXQq47c3CjeZcEbcXcz86Zs
transaction
264210a42ff77c6f5bfb33faa8650b360deb3244649adb8c601f8f00e3b7aa89
confirmations
316110
spent
true